WebThe getline helps us to get everything in the line entered by the user. #include using namespace std; int main() { string name; cout << "Enter your name: \n"; getline(cin, name); cout << "Hello " << name; return 0; } WebMay 31, 2024 · Check the length of the input buffer - even though fgets () discards extra input, the user should be informed if input has exceeded available space and allowed to re-enter the data. Convert input to an integer using strtol (). If input meets the length constraint and can be interpreted as an integer, the loop ends. Example: Read Integer
